Netflix
Eleonora
Andreatta
VP, Italian Original Series
As director of Rai Fiction — where she was Italy’s most powerful commissioning editor, clocking in some 25 years at the public-service broadcaster — Andreatta bolstered the creative reputation of Italian scripted production with global hits such as “My Brilliant Friend,” “Inspector Moltebano” and historical drama “Medici: Masters of Florence.” Her 2020 move to Netflix shows the potential the mega-streamer sees in Italy, where it is upping investment and opening a Rome base, moving its Italian team from their previous Amsterdam headquarters. At Rai, Andreatta created some 500 hours of TV drama per year at the company’s three channels and its RAI Play streaming platform. Overseeing the production of Italian original series, the exec affectionately known as “Tinny” will create big event dramas showcasing Italy’s remarkable culture and history and develop a slate of modern stories.
